Following an eight-wicket defeat to Kolkata Knight Riders in IPL 2026, Delhi Capitals captain Axar Patel admitted that both the team's batting and bowling units underperformed. This loss has significantly diminished the team's playoff hopes, leading Patel to indicate that the team is already looking ahead to planning for the next IPL season.
